Invest Atlanta

Invest Atlanta is the official economic development authority for the City of Atlanta, established in 1997. It encompasses the Urban Residential Finance Authority, Downtown Development Authority, and the Atlanta Economic Renaissance Corporation, with subsidiaries including Atlanta BeltLine, Inc. The agency is dedicated to enhancing Atlanta's economy and global competitiveness, aiming to create greater opportunities and prosperity for its residents. Governed by a nine-member board of directors, chaired by the Mayor of Atlanta, Invest Atlanta focuses on strategic initiatives that foster economic growth and development within the city.
